One of the greatest names in medieval medicine is that ofAbu Bakr Muhammad ibn Zakariya' al-Razi, who was born in the Iranian City of Rayy in 865 (251 H) and died in the same town about 925 (312 H). This is not a book about different health care systems, but rather a book about how differently doctors & patients in these countries apply diagnoses and therapies, and which, often unspoken ideologies are involved.
